聚合级函数允许您指定哪些属性对报表中的指标进行切片,从而使您能够更好地控制Explore报表。
通常,当您向报表添加一个度量和多个属性时,度量被所有这些属性分割。您不能阻止属性对指标进行切片,也不能添加在后台对指标进行切片而不出现在报告中的属性。然而,使用聚合级函数,您可以精确地指定哪些属性将分割度量。
本文包含以下主题:
可用的聚合级函数
探索以下聚合级函数的特性。
函数 | 描述 | 例子 |
---|---|---|
ATTRIBUTE_FIX(metric, attribute1, attribute2,…) | 仅根据函数中指定的属性对度量进行切片。 添加到报表的属性(在列或行面板)将不切片度量,但任何过滤器应用将被考虑在内。 可用于防止报表结果受到特定属性的影响,这对于计算百分比特别有用。 |
在本例中,将返回一年中每个月的首次回复时间的中位数,而不考虑添加到报表中的属性。 |
ATTRIBUTE_ADD(metric, attribute1, attribute2,…) | 将度量聚合扩展到函数中指定的属性除了…之外这些都被添加到报告中。 添加到报告中的属性将对度量进行切片,并且将考虑应用的任何过滤器。 可用于基于报表中不存在的属性计算预聚合的度量平均值或中位数。 |
在本例中,在按报表属性聚合之前,将返回每年每个月的首次回复时间的中位数。 |
使用ATTRIBUTE_FIX函数
下面的第一个示例展示了ATTRIBUTE_FIX函数是如何工作的,第二个示例给出了一个潜在的用例。
求每组的总票数
这个例子说明了ATTRIBUTE_FIX函数是如何工作的。您将创建一个指标,该指标返回每个组中的门票总数,而不按报告中的属性分割。
求每组的总票数
- 创建一个新报告在支持-票务数据集。
- 创建一个标准的计算度量命名团体票固定公式如下:
ATTRIBUTE_FIX(COUNT(Tickets), [Ticket group])
- 在指标面板中,添加票和团体票固定指标。使用总和第二个度量的聚合器。
- 在行面板中,添加票组属性。此时,两个指标都显示了每组中的票数。
- 在行面板中,添加机票状态属性。现在,票标准是按票的状态和组划分的,但是团体票固定度量忽略票证状态,并且仅按票证组进行切片。
从季度量中查找票的百分比
在本例中,您将创建一个报告,其中显示每个月创建的门票占每个季度创建的门票总数的百分比。
从季度量中查找票的百分比
- 创建一个新报告在支持-票务数据集。
- 创建一个标准的计算度量命名季度销量百分比公式如下:
COUNT(票)/ ATTRIBUTE_FIX(COUNT(票),[票创建-年],[票创建-季度])
- 打开刚刚创建的计算指标,单击选项>编辑显示格式,并选择%在第一个领域。
- 在指标面板中,添加票和季度销量百分比指标。使用总和第二个度量的聚合器。
- 在行面板,添加以下属性:
- 已创建门票-年
- 创造门票-季票
- 创建的票-月
您的报告应该如下所示:
使用ATTRIBUTE_ADD函数
下面的第一个示例展示了ATTRIBUTE_ADD函数是如何工作的,随后的示例给出了潜在的用例。
求每组的平均票数
这个例子说明了ATTRIBUTE_ADD函数是如何工作的。您将创建一个度量,该度量返回每个组的平均票数,而无需将groups属性添加到报告中。
求每组的平均票数
- 创建一个新报告在支持-票务数据集。
- 创建一个标准的计算度量命名团体票公式如下:
ATTRIBUTE_ADD(COUNT(Tickets), [Ticket group])
- 在指标面板中,添加票指标。
- 在行面板中,添加票组属性。
- 打开结果操作()菜单,选择总数,并设置总计:来行与AVG聚合器。
- 在指标面板中,添加团体票您创建的计算指标。使用AVG聚合器。报告中的两个指标都显示了每个组的门票数量,每个组的平均值显示在表格的底部。但是,在本例中,您不想在表上显示组,而只想显示每个组的平均票数。
- 在行面板,拆下票组属性,并删除总结果操作。的票度量返回您帐户中的门票总数,但是团体票固定返回每个组的平均票数。
- (可选)在行面板,添加任何您想要分割指标的附加属性。例如,添加机票状态属性。现在,票度量返回每个状态下的票总数,但是团体票返回每个状态下每个组的平均票数。
找出每个季度或每年每月的平均票价和中位数
在本例中,您将创建一个报告,其中显示每月创建的平均票和中位数票。
找出每个季度或每年每月的平均票价和中位数
- 创建一个新报告在支持-票务数据集。
- 创建一个标准的计算度量命名每月门票公式如下:
ATTRIBUTE_ADD(COUNT(Tickets),[创建的门票-年],[创建的门票-月])
- 在指标面板中,添加票和每月门票指标。使用AVG和地中海第二个指标的聚合器。(要选择多个聚合器,请展开度量并选择要添加的每个聚合器。)
- 在行面板中,添加已创建门票-年和创造门票-季票属性。因此,您的报告显示了每个季度每月的平均票价和中位数:
- (可选)拆卸已发行门票-季票属性可查看每年每月的平均票价和中位数。
找出每个受让人的最高平均解决时间
在本例中,您将创建一个KPI,显示所有被分配人员的最高平均解析时间。
找出每个受让人的最高平均解决时间
- 创建一个新报告在支持-票务数据集。
- 创建一个标准的计算度量命名每个受让人的解决时间公式如下:
ATTRIBUTE_ADD(AVG(全分辨率时间(天)),[受让人ID])
- 打开刚刚创建的计算指标,单击选项>编辑显示格式.
- 在第一个字段中,选择自定义,然后设置小数位来1和后缀来天(单词前加空格)。
- 在指标面板中,添加每个受让人的解决时间指标。使用马克斯聚合器。
- 在过滤器面板中,添加已解决的罚单-日期属性并将其配置为显示最近30天内解决的票据。
你的报告显示了过去30天内所有被分配人员的最高平均解决时间。
求每个代理的平均票评论数
在本例中,您将创建一个条形图,显示每个票务代理提交的评论的平均数量。
求每个代理的平均票务评论数
- 创建一个新报告在支持-票务数据集。
- 创建一个标准的计算度量命名每张票的评论公式如下:
ATTRIBUTE_ADD(COUNT(Comments), [Update ticket ID])
- 打开刚刚创建的计算指标,单击选项>编辑显示格式.
- 在第一个字段中,选择自定义,然后设置小数位来1.
- 在指标面板中,添加每张票的评论指标。使用AVG聚合器。
- 在过滤器面板,添加以下属性:
- 更新-日期:设置此选项以显示上周的更新。
- 更新器作用:设置为排除终端用户。
- 在可视化类型()菜单,选择酒吧.
该报告显示了每个代理的平均票务评论数。
13个评论
嗨@……
谢谢你。看起来很有趣。我们的代理一直在问他们如何将他们的月度Sat成绩与过去12个月的平均Sat成绩进行比较。因此,查询将有最近几个月的Sat分数的条形图,然后是2021年Sat平均分数的趋势线。然后,代理将能够看到他们当前月的Sat分数与平均水平的趋势。感觉像是一个简单的功能,但我们无法实现它。这些新功能会有助于实现这一点吗?尝试了一些变化,但似乎不能让它工作
嗨弗拉基米尔,
我们可能需要进一步调查这一点,因此将代表您创建一个单独的票,我们可以继续调查这一点。
干杯!
问题,用什么公式来比较一个球员的平均全时解析度和球队的平均全时解析度?在小时。
你能使用Attribute_Fix吗?
如果您希望显示每个代理的解析时间和组的平均值,那么可以使用attribute_fix来构建一个仅按票务组划分的指标。但是,如果您要做的是将个人解决时间与整个团队(而不是票务/代理组)的平均解决时间进行比较,那么您可能需要使用一个固定的计算指标(添加固定的计算指标).
大家好——
我很难让ATTRIBUTE_FIX函数在Ticket Updates数据集中的查询上一致地加载指标。我认为这对于构建一个指标很有用,它可以按月创建或解决门票数量,同时还可以根据各种属性(如单个代理或代理组)划分另一个指标,如处理时间,这样您就可以根据时间序列上的每月总量来衡量这些指标。如果我使用“Update - Date”时间属性作为过滤器超过一天的数据值,我会超时,但当我只看那一天时,它看起来是正确的。ATTRIBUTE_FIX函数是否真的不能很好地用于Ticket Updates数据集,还是我的方法本身就有问题?
属性函数可以在任何数据集中使用。让我请继续为您创建一个单独的票证,以便我可以获得更多特定于帐户的详细信息来解决此问题。请期待不久的邮件与机票信息。
嘿,
首先感谢这篇文章。ATTRIBUTE_FIX的用例对我来说似乎非常清楚。但是,我在理解ATTRIBUTE_ADD的目的时遇到了一些麻烦。从理论上讲,这是有道理的,但我对最后一个例子感到困惑:“显示一个月内从一个渠道收到的最大门票数量,而不显示渠道名称”。
我的困惑是:
该指标返回一个月内所有通道收到的最大票证数。在这种情况下,我们为什么不使用默认的COUNT(票)指标呢?
然而,如果我们想要返回一个(且只有一个)通道接收到的最大票证数,难道我们不能在度量中添加一个过滤器,只选择一个通道吗?
这一点在文章中似乎并不清楚。提前感谢您的帮助!
劳拉,
嗨劳拉
这是个好问题。正如文章所描述的,“这个示例演示了如何使用ATTRIBUTE_ADD函数,该函数通过报告中的所有属性加上您指定的属性来分割您指定的度量。”
正如您所看到的,ATTRIBUTE_ADD实际上使用COUNT(票证)度量来表示示例中自定义计算的度量:
这适用于本文中希望显示结果而不需要对数据进行切片的场景,因此,由于不想列出年份,只想要一个平均值,因此不需要添加COUNT(门票)+一年内创建的门票属性,而是使用ATTRIBUTE_ADD创建自己的度量。
希望这能澄清问题!如果您有任何后续问题,请告诉我。
你好Dainne Lucena,
谢谢你的回复。
然而,我的问题仍然盛行。
在您提供的示例中,呈现的是哪一年的结果?你不用指定是哪一年吗?
自ATTRIBUTE_ADD返回值以来的所有年份聚合器(指标名称)聚合到报告中的所有属性attribute1和attribute2.
嗨尤金·奥,我需要你的专家帮助=)
我使用这个公式来查找整个Zendesk实例(它只有一个)中解决的门票的全球平均值亚博单品牌)。我可以用datsolved这个指标对报告进行切片,以获得每个时间段的平均值。
然而,当有多个品牌在Zendesk亚博(因为给平均每个品牌)。真的有任何属性是整个Zendesk实例的全局属性吗亚博多个品牌吗?找不到任何东西,自定义属性似乎也不起作用。
您可以尝试使用SUM聚合器而不是COUNT。我试图进行查询,并将其与每个品牌的实际解决票进行比较,并提供了相同的数据。
丹麦人嘿,谢谢你回来。你好像没听懂我的意思。(收集让我用另一种方式解释。
我不需要在账户上计算每个品牌的数据。我需要整个账目与多个品牌。你看到了吗?
请登录留下评论。